Our research area “Nonlinear Dynamics and Chaos” is an interdisciplinary area of work where we study the nonlinear dynamical behaviour in dynamical systems designed for various real world problems. Our work established that “Wave of Chaos” phenomenon can be a possible cause for the Plankton Patchiness problem of marine ecosystem. Our work also focuses on Nonlinear Reaction Diffusion models of real world problems and study of various Nonlinear phenomena exhibited by such systems. We are pursuing research in novel platforms for computation as well as in Mathematical biology. We are also working in the area of  "Machine Learning in Dynamical Systems".
